Michael Jordan’s Championship Sneakers Head to Auction: A Collectible Ensemble

In an electrifying event for basketball enthusiasts and collectors alike, a set of six sneakers that were worn by the legendary Michael Jordan during his NBA championship-clinching games is about to hit the auction block. After being held privately for years, these iconic pieces of sports history are now poised to be sold to the highest bidder in an upcoming auction organized by prestigious auction house Sotheby’s. The highly anticipated auction, which opens on February 2nd, proudly presents these sneakers as part of a larger collection and boasts an impressive pre-sale estimate of $7 million to $10 million.

The sneakers, famously known as The Dynasty Collection, were once cherished belongings of a private collector who acquired them from Tim Hallam, the public relations director for the Chicago Bulls during the team’s remarkable era of dominance in the 1990s. A unique tradition emerged where Jordan would present Hallam with one of his game-worn shoes after each Finals victory, leading to the formation of this extraordinary collection.

This remarkable collection, aptly named by Sotheby’s as The Dynasty Collection, showcases a range of Air Jordans that Jordan wore during his illustrious career, specifically during the Bulls’ championship years from 1991 through 1998. Each of the sneakers in the collection has been personally autographed by Michael Jordan, the Finals MVP in each of those championship series.

On display at the 2022 National Sports Collectors Convention in Atlantic City, this collection captures the essence of Jordan’s style evolution and the advancements in sneaker technology over the years. It includes iconic models such as the Air Jordan VI (1991), inspired by Jordan’s love for his Porsche 911, the groundbreaking Air Jordan VII (1992), the first model without Nike branding, the Air Jordan VIII (1993) featuring the innovative “x-strap” design, the beloved and legendary “Bred” Air Jordan XI (1996) known for its translucent sole, the Nike Zoom Air-equipped Air Jordan XII (1997), and the iconic “Last Shot” Air Jordan XIV (1998), which early on reflected his connection to his Ferrari 550 Maranello.

Adding to the allure of this collection is a set of unique signed photographs that capture Jordan in the moments immediately following each championship win, wearing only one sneaker – the other already in Hallam’s possession. This lighthearted yet historic exchange between Jordan and Hallam further highlights the personal nature and the authentic connection of this collection to the basketball legend.

The authenticity and historical significance of these sneakers have undergone rigorous verification processes, including detailed certification and extensive high-resolution photographic documentation by reputable experts such as CSG. This meticulous approach ensures that collectors can confidently acquire these coveted pieces of sports history.

This auction comes on the heels of the groundbreaking sale of another pair of Jordan’s sneakers worn during the 1998 Finals Game 2, which shattered records by selling for a staggering $2.2 million, the highest price ever paid for game-worn shoes.
